So far, I have found this solution which basically says to avoid removing widgets from the root, and though I have tried it, I lost references and my app crashes. I don't also want to put the element in a position out of the visible screen, so I wonder if somebody knows a way to hide and show widgets as 'self.widget_name.hide()orself.widget_name.hide = True`, or can somebody tell me a good way to achieve this task?

Best Answer

Should work for every widget & use case:

def hide_widget(wid, dohide=True):
    if hasattr(wid, 'saved_attrs'):
        if not dohide:
            wid.height, wid.size_hint_y, wid.opacity, wid.disabled = wid.saved_attrs
            del wid.saved_attrs
    elif dohide:
        wid.saved_attrs = wid.height, wid.size_hint_y, wid.opacity, wid.disabled
        wid.height, wid.size_hint_y, wid.opacity, wid.disabled = 0, None, 0, True
